{"graph_symbol","#* Default symbols to use for graph creation, \"braille\", \"block\" or \"tty\".\n"
"#* \"braille\" offers the highest resolution but might not be included in all fonts.\n"
"#* \"block\" has half the resolution of braille but uses more common characters.\n"
"#* \"tty\" uses only 3 different symbols but will work with most fonts and should work in a real TTY.\n"
"#* Note that \"tty\" only has half the horizontal resolution of the other two, so will show a shorter historical view."},
